1#	$NetBSD: srcs.inc,v 1.1.1.2 2023/04/18 14:19:04 christos Exp $
2
3CRYPTOINCS= \
4aes.inc \
5aria.inc \
6asn1.inc \
7async.inc \
8bf.inc \
9bio.inc \
10blake2.inc \
11bn.inc \
12buffer.inc \
13camellia.inc \
14cast.inc \
15chacha.inc \
16cmac.inc \
17cms.inc \
18comp.inc \
19conf.inc \
20crypto.inc \
21ct.inc \
22curve448.inc \
23des.inc \
24dh.inc \
25dsa.inc \
26dso.inc \
27ec.inc \
28engine.inc \
29err.inc \
30evp.inc \
31hmac.inc \
32idea.inc \
33kdf.inc \
34lhash.inc \
35md2.inc \
36md4.inc \
37md5.inc \
38mdc2.inc \
39modes.inc \
40objects.inc \
41ocsp.inc \
42pem.inc \
43pkcs12.inc \
44pkcs7.inc \
45poly1305.inc \
46rand.inc \
47rc2.inc \
48rc4.inc \
49ripemd.inc \
50rsa.inc \
51seed.inc \
52sha.inc \
53siphash.inc \
54sm2.inc \
55sm3.inc \
56sm4.inc \
57srp.inc \
58stack.inc \
59store.inc \
60ts.inc \
61txt_db.inc \
62ui.inc \
63whrlpool.inc \
64x509.inc \
65x509v3.inc \
66
67# patented algorithms - see ../libcrypto_*
68CRYPTOINCS+=	rc5.inc
69
70CRYPTOINCS+=	man.inc
71
72.if exists(${.CURDIR}/arch/${MACHINE_ARCH})
73CRYPTO_MACHINE_CPU?=    ${MACHINE_ARCH}
74.else
75CRYPTO_MACHINE_CPU?=    ${MACHINE_CPU}
76.endif
77
78.for cryptoinc in ${CRYPTOINCS}
79.if exists(${.CURDIR}/arch/${CRYPTO_MACHINE_CPU}/${cryptoinc})
80.include "${.CURDIR}/arch/${CRYPTO_MACHINE_CPU}/${cryptoinc}"
81.else
82.include "${cryptoinc}"
83.endif
84.endfor
85